Helix X550 Maduro

This cigar is a great daily smoke.  I always keep a box aging on the bottom shelf of my humidor because I love to share these when folks come over to hang out.  I’m not one for a-buck-a-stick smokes because I found that $2 cigars have so much more value to them.


The Helix Maduros taste great, these cigars have an excellent draw, and lots of white smoke comes out full of maduro flavor.  These are on the light side of the spectrum for a maduro… which makes it great for an anytime smoke without tiring you out.


It has a very good construction with an oily wrapper that burns evenly with a white ash.  Its got hints of chocolate, nuts, wood, and spice with a nice aroma that you can be proud of from a two-dollar stogie.


Origin: Honduras
Length: 5"
Ring: 50
Strength: Medium
Wrapper Color: Dark Brown
Wrapper Type: Connecticut Broadleaf
Price: $2.25


CPH Staff Rating: 8 out of 10


CPH Staff Comments: Very good cigar, multi-toned with a great draw.  This is a good maduro that pairs with a glass of port really well.  I like to dip the tip in the glass between puffs for more complex flavors.

Macanudo Maduro Diplomat (Figurado)

This is one of the most mild maduro cigars around.  It’s really smooth with a little bit of chocolate, a little coffee, some caramel, and a little earth and spice.


It was one of my first cigars ever, probably because it is so smooth and tasty.


It’s a pleasure to smoke.  This shorty will surprise you buy lasting up to 40 minutes as the white ash grows so long that your almost done with it before you can flick it off.


Origin: Dominican Republic
Length: 4½"
Ring: 60
Strength: Mild-Medium
Wrapper Color: Dark Brown Maduro
Price: $5 to $6


CPH Staff Rating: 9 out of 10

CPH Staff Comments: Good cigar!  Well done General Cigar Company, this is one that can always be found in my humidor.
